The stories found within the pages of this book are meant to entertain, and perhaps, to tickle the imagination. It unfolds with the story of the earth and our relationship with it. It also explains in layman's terms the laws that are supposed to protect the Earth, and how they can be used to advance that goal. The book also tells us the story of a suffering land, air and water and the human habitations. It highlights local stories and examples of good environmental governance. Atty. Tony Oposa - environmental lawyer, a natural teacher and storyteller wrote the book.
